Myrtle's Barn is a new conversion of a red brick barn. Old on the outside with a modern, open plan feel on the inside. Beautiful private garden with stunning views over the open Norfolk countryside.

Myrtle’s Barn (named after Edward’s grandmother) is located at the former farm in Briningham, just off the B1110 (Dereham to Holt road) and looks across the valley over fields and more fields. The barn sleeps six in three bedrooms, all ensuite.
The Master Bedroom is upstairs. The room is dominated by floor to ceiling glass windows opening out to the garden. It has a kingsize bed and a large ensuite bathroom with shower and bath.
The Second Bedroom is also upstairs and is a large room with high ceilings. It has a Super King bed which can be split into two single beds. There is an ensuite shower room.
The Third Bedroom is downstairs in the new extension. It has an ensuite shower room with a tiled floor. Like the Master Bedroom it enjoys plenty of natural light from the floor to ceiling glass. (Blackout blinds are installed on these windows and doors to aid that all important holiday lie in!) This bedroom has a Super King bed which can be split into two single beds.
All the bedrooms and bathrooms are finished and furnished to a very high standard. All the bedrooms are fully carpeted. Upstairs bathrooms are also carpeted.. Each bedroom has plenty of cupboard storage for clothes and bits and pieces and bedside tables. All the bathrooms have electric towel rails, electric mirrors and shaver and toothbrush sockets. We provide all bed linen, bath towels, hand towels and bath mats. The velux windows all have powered blackout blinds.
Entry to Myrtle’s Barn is in the new extension into a hall, off which is a downstairs toilet. There is plenty of room for coats, hats and boots in the hall, as well as a large cupboard housing the washing machine/tumble dryer etc.
The hall leads into the kitchen which is partly open to the main living area. The kitchen is very modern in design. As with The Pig House – the kitchen has been designed by a local kitchen company (Arcadia) and the kitchen has been manufactured by Siematic in Germany. There is a large breakfast bar (three stools from Quadrtropi) with a Bora integrated hob (as in The Pig House). There is plenty of cupboard and drawer space. The kitchen has a bottle fridge, huge Bosch fridge freezer, Bosch integrated double oven and microwave and integrated dishwasher and a washing machine/tumble dryer. All of the kitchens in our properties are very well equipped with good quality cooking equipment. I used to be a professional cook – so think that self-catering holiday homes should have good cooking equipment and all that is necessary to make a great meal with!
The open plan living area is dominated by the enormously high ceiling with four striking pendant lights… suspended from quite a height! The glass sided oak stair case heads upwards to a glass sided bridge which links the two upstairs bedrooms. The dining table sits below this bridge and comes from Neptune. It is 245cm long and will generously seat 6 people and happily sit quite a few more! Adjacent to the dining area is the living area, slightly separated by two oak posts which help to support the upper floor. The living area has two large three seater sofas and a single chair. There is a 50” television and a woodburner to help create that cosy feeling in the winter. (Wood is provided during the winter).
Outside Myrtle’s Barn there is a large fenced garden and a large patio area, positioned carefully to make the most of the afternoon and evening sun, with Bramblecrest outdoor dining furniture. There is ample off road parking, an EV charging point and car port.
Myrtle’s Barn is a perfect base for a family of up to six to come and stay. Myrtles Barn is located next to Harold’s Barn which also sleeps six. Taken together the two barns offer two family groups an excellent base from which to holiday together whilst having the privacy of their own property.
Out of season guests may choose to have one bedroom locked and receive a discounted price. Please contact Victoria for details. The barn is equally perfect for three couples (all super king beds, all ensuite) to get away for a week or weekend break. We are surrounded by gastropubs and other great places to eat, all within easy driving distance.
Briningham is ideally located for exploring Norfolk – especially the North Norfolk coastline – Blakeney, Cromer, Sheringham, Wells-Next-to-Sea, Holkham and equally well positioned for inland attractions such as Roar!!! (Dinosaur Adventure Park), Bewilderwood, Pensthorpe Natural Park as well as Norwich for city centre shopping and of course Holt (just up the road) for a more boutique shopping experience.
